Rolly Romero pushes Teofimo Lopez to the limit in a razor-thin majority decision loss in Las Vegas. One judge scores it a draw, and many believe Rolly did enough to retain his title.
Lopez displayed a lot of toughness to rally from bad moments in the fight and just about edged a majority decision.
Some thought it could have gone the other way though. Rolly disputed the defeat after.
Some notes on tonight’s live boxing results and action in Vegas a short time ago;
- Teofimo Lopez won a majority decision over Rolly Romero in a controversially close Vegas scrap
- Scorecards: 116-112, 115-113 for Lopez, and 114-114 even—proof of how tight it was
- Rolly hurt Lopez badly in the 5th with a left hook that opened a gash over his eye
- Lopez survived the scare and recovered to outwork Rolly down the stretch
- Rolly landed the cleaner, harder shots but threw far fewer punches
- Lopez outlanded Rolly 124 to 78, but many felt Rolly’s shots had more impact
- Rolly’s patient counter-punching style made Lopez miss often and look ordinary
- The crowd buzzed after Rolly’s 5th-round surge but booed the lack of sustained action
- Rolly slammed the decision post-fight, insisting he was never in real trouble
- Many fans and pundits felt Rolly did enough to retain his title, calling the decision a gift
